Battery-powered lawn cutting system
First Claim
1. A height adjustment apparatus that adjusts the height of a lawnmower chassis, comprising:
- a first wheel axle having first and second ends;
a first pivot arm, interconnected with said first end of said first axle, and having a first pivot interconnected with said chassis;
a second pivot arm, interconnected with said second end of said first axle, having a second pivot interconnected with said chassis, said first axle and said chassis being the only members that directly connect said first and second pivot arms to each other;
a second wheel axle having first and second ends;
a third pivot arm, interconnected with said first end of said second axle, having a third pivot interconnected with said chassis;
a fourth pivot arm, interconnected with said second end of said second axle, having a fourth pivot interconnected with said chassis, said second axle and said chassis being the only members that directly connect said third and fourth pivot arms to each other;
means for pivoting said first pivot arm about its first pivot; and
link means for pivoting said third pivot arm about its third pivot in response to the pivoting of said first pivot arm;
whereby the pivoting of said first pivot arm by said pivoting means rotates said first wheel axle to thereby pivot said second pivot arm about said second pivot;
whereby the pivoting of said first pivot arm by said pivoting means causes said link means to pivot said third pivot arm about its third pivot; and
whereby the pivoting of said third pivot arm by said link means rotates said second wheel axle to pivot said fourth pivot arm about said fourth pivot, thereby adjusting the height of said lawnmower chassis.

Abstract
The improved battery-powered lawnmower includes a safety key that is automatically removed when the removable battery is removed, while at the same time blocking the battery recharger receptacle. The lawnmower also includes a control circuit that shuts off the lawnmower upon the occurrence of one or more of several predetermined conditions, including low battery voltage, the encountering of heavy grass for a period of 3 seconds or more, and high motor current that may occur when the cutting blade is jammed. The cutting blade is designed to move through any debris accumulated between the blade ends and the housing sidewall without sacrificing the lift for needed cutting and mulching. The invention also includes a unique height adjustment assembly for adjusting the height of the chassis, a handle attachment that allows the handle to be positively tightened to the lawnmower chassis, and a telescoping groove for the battery'"'"'s quick connect/disconnect terminals.
